A night at the races representing reserve

The Air Force Reserve was represented at a recent Indy car race. As part of the pre-event backstage program, members of the 932nd Airlift Wing met some teams of Indy cars on "pit row" as they prepped engines and tires at the Gateway track. At center in blue uniform, 932nd Airlift Wing Maintenance Group commander, Col. Sharon Johnson, was recognized on stage with the Indy drivers at the Bommarito Automotive Group 500 race Aug. 25, 2018, Gateway Motorsports Park, Madison, Illinois. Johnson was an honored VIP to help kick off the second annual IndyCar race which was won by Will Power, who actually came in last place the year prior. This year he won the 248-lap race around the four-turn, 1.25-mile Gateway Motorsports Park paved track in Madison, Illinois, in his #12 Chevrolet car by 1.3117 seconds over second place finisher Alexander Rossi. The 932nd Airlift Wing was represented by maintenance, medical, public affairs staff and operations personnel. (U.S. Air Force photo by Lt. Col. Stan Paregien
